Plugin authors integrating with the AgriLink telemetry gateway must witness this step. Confirm the gateway's field-unit signing key has been regenerated and that all plugin manifests are re-signed against it. Telemetry from harvesters and irrigation controllers will be rejected until manifests match the new key. Distribute the updated trust bundle through the plugin portal only after two witnesses initial this item. Should the escrow shard fail to load, unlock the backup shard with the recovery passphrase given below.

unlock words, kawig-bawef: belax-sorir-druax-ulaiel-wenael-belael

Account Recovery — Pagewright Static Builds

If a customer loses access to their Pagewright dashboard, incremental rebuilds of their static site will continue from the last known-good deploy, so no content is lost during recovery. Confirm the customer's last rebuild timestamp in the Orlin console, then initiate the recovery flow from the admin panel. Do not trigger a full rebuild until access is restored. Unlocking the recovery flow requires the passphrase below.

recovery phrase for yadup-taguf: wenael-quenox-kelix

## Deep-link routing in Fernpath Mobile

All inbound links pass through the RouteGate validator before dispatch. Unrecognized schemes are dropped, not forwarded. Parameters are allowlisted per route; anything outside the allowlist is stripped and logged. Links cannot trigger authenticated actions directly — they resolve to a screen, and the screen enforces its own auth check. Verified app-links only; custom schemes are deprecated and rejected in prod builds. The full route allowlist and validation rules live on the internal page.

runbook for tafof-yawif: https://confluence.tolvaqsys.internal/display/display/browse/pages/7be3